Output 08034a3ef36084b6e968572e4e19a81ce4c84afe46ee7b7bbe12ed80a9e33d05:0

value
3051
script pubkey
OP_0 OP_PUSHBYTES_20 d538129c743c10095c15026961c2902bcf5a7aa8
address
tb1q65up98r58sgqjhq4qf5krs5s9084574gvtwx8g
transaction
08034a3ef36084b6e968572e4e19a81ce4c84afe46ee7b7bbe12ed80a9e33d05
confirmations
27953
spent
true